    Interior CS Fred Matiang’i accompanied by tourism CS, Najib Balala and transport CS James Macharia surprised workers at the the Jomo Kenyatta International Airport after they stopped by at the wee hours of the morning.

    Fred Matiang'i
    /courtesy

    According to the spokesperson for the interior ministry said that the cabinet secretaries wanted to check on the security situation at the airport and that was the main reason for their visit.

    Cs Fred Matiangi’i who holds two dockets seems to be a hard worker as he also visited schools to witness the initiation of the new system of education. He said that he would moving across schools for the next two weeks to check on the receptiveness of the system.
